トップへ戻るニュースフォーラムFLASH-ML 過去ログBak@Flaダウンロードよくある質問と答
ログイン
ユーザ名:

パスワード:


パスワード紛失

新規登録
メインメニュー
メイン
   迷える子羊の部屋【初心者専用】
     FLASH で 日本語入力のON/OFF・・・?
投稿するにはまず登録を

スレッド表示 | 新しいものから 前のトピック | 次のトピック | 下へ
投稿者 スレッド
せいぞう
Åê¹ÆNo.18953
投稿日時: 2005-7-21 0:13
常連
居住地: 江戸川区の某所
投稿: 125
使用環境:
Flash CS5.5
Windows8 (64Bit)
Pentium Core i7
Memory 8GB
FLASH で 日本語入力のON/OFF・・・?
いつもお世話になっております。m(_ _)m

掲題のように「FLASHで 日本語入力のON/OFF」が出来ない
ものかなぁ・・・?と悩んでいるところです。

WEB上で探したところ、Directorでは、めちゃんこややこしい方法
を使えばできるような、ことが書いてあったのですが(巻末ご参照)FLASHに関しては、良い情報に行き着いていないんです。

因みに、調べていて判ったんですがこういうことを「FEP(ふぇっぷ)のコントロール」って言うんですね。
恥ずかしながら、この言葉、初めて知りました。(^^;)

ご助言頂ければ幸です。よろしくお願いします。m(_ _)m


■ご参考:DirectorのFEPコントロールの件
http://www.macromedia.com/jp/support/director/ts/documents/dr0205.html


----------------
□NAME : せいぞう
□URL : http://www.5th-trend.com/

Fla4man
Åê¹ÆNo.18955
投稿日時: 2005-7-21 1:27
職人
居住地: かまくら
投稿: 517
使用環境:
WinMe,Win2000,
Flash4,アズさん,大仏、delphi
Re: FLASH で 日本語入力のON/OFF・・・?
ほんとはこういうのはFEP制御とはいわず一般的には「IME制御」といいます。

「言います」というのはより一般的であり
探索キーワードでより有効な情報が多量に得られるという意味です。

でリンク先の前提はWWWでは無いと思います。

とするとWindowsであればFlashはActiveXコンポーネントなので
1:ベースとなるアプリケーションにIMEのON OFF機能をつけてやる

あるいは
2:寄生型アプリケーションを併用する

別のアプリケーションでブラウザのIME制御ができ
それがVBスクリプトで制御できるならば
ムービーからはFscommandでコントロールできるという構造になると思います。

3:IMEを実装する。
 OSのIMEに頼らず自前で実装する手です。
はっきりいってMS-IMEとかの変換は辞書を大きめにして何年使っても
全然だめです。
だったらローマ字変換でJISコード対応表プラスアルファを作っておけばIMEが作れます
固有単語とかはsharedobject使うなんてのもありだと思います

多分希望のゴールは2の付加アプリケーションによる任意のウィンドウのIMEのコントロールということになるのでは無いかと思います


----------------
通常のハンドル名:×○○× ねた回収モードに突入 現在1/100

植木友浩
Åê¹ÆNo.18960
投稿日時: 2005-7-21 3:27
案内係
居住地: 東京
投稿: 640
使用環境:
Pro +
.Tiger +
Re: FLASH で 日本語入力のON/OFF・・・?
http://www.forest.impress.co.jp/article/2005/07/13/flashplayer8beta.html

を見ると、次のバージョンのFlashプレイヤーで制御できるみたいです。


----------------
Tomohiro Ueki
RSSリーダー公開中
チーム-10kg達成

森 巧尚
Åê¹ÆNo.18961
投稿日時: 2005-7-21 3:43
モデレータ
居住地: 宝塚
投稿: 650
使用環境:
.5/CS4/Safari3
XP+2000//IE6
Re: FLASH で 日本語入力のON/OFF・・・?
引用:

Fla4manさんは書きました:
ほんとはこういうのはFEP制御とはいわず一般的には「IME制御」といいます。
ほんとは「IME(Input Method Editor)」ってWindows用語なのでMacで使う場合はおかしいんですけどね。(笑)
ただ、FEP(Front End Preprocessor)は昔のDOSの頃からの用語なので、今検索をするなら両方で検索するのがいいかもしれませんね。

で「Directorでは、めちゃんこややこしい方法」ってことですが、KI IME Xtraは、本来なら自分でしないといけないややこしい処理を、これを使うだけで簡単にON/OFFできるという便利なXtraですよ。私、以前お世話になったことがあります。

ただ、やはり今のバージョンのFlashだけでは、FEP(IME)は制御できないようですね。

Fla4manさんが上げられている以外の方法としては、DirectorとKI IME XtraとFlashを組み合わせて使うという方法も考えられますね。
ただ、このXtraはプロジェクタとしてしか動かなくて、Shockwaveでは動かないので、この方法もWEB用としては使えませんけどね。

ーーー追加
そうそう。植木さんが言うように次のバージョンを待つというのが一番簡単そうですね。


----------------
森 巧尚
http://www.ymori.com

せいぞう
Åê¹ÆNo.18965
投稿日時: 2005-7-21 8:31
常連
居住地: 江戸川区の某所
投稿: 125
使用環境:
Flash CS5.5
Windows8 (64Bit)
Pentium Core i7
Memory 8GB
Re: FLASH で 日本語入力のON/OFF・・・?
せいぞうです。
Fla4manさん、植木さん、森さん、貴重なコメントありがとうございます。
たいへん参考になりました。

森さんのおっしゃるように、KI IME Xtraは実はとても便利なものなんですね。 しかぁし、残念ながら(私の脳ミソのキャパシティのせいで) 私しめには、ちょっと手が出せない代物だなぁ・・・・と、能力の無さを痛感している次第です。(^^;)

そんな私なので、現在ぶつかっているオシゴトの問題は、応急の手立てでしのぐこととして、植木さんご紹介の「次バージョンプレーヤ」の登場を待ちたいと思っております。

重ね重ね、皆様にお礼申し上げます。m(_ _)m

PS:それから "FEP"等の語彙に関しても、勉強になりました。
ありがとうございました。<(_ _)>


----------------
□NAME : せいぞう
□URL : http://www.5th-trend.com/

スレッド表示 | 新しいものから 前のトピック | 次のトピック | トップ

投稿するにはまず登録を
 
Copyright (C) 2003 FLASH-japan. All rights reserved.
Powered by Xoops